8. How much money hould a couple place in a time depoit in a bank that pay 10% compounded annually o that they will have ₱500,000. 00 after 5 year?
To find out how much money a couple should place in a time deposit to have ₱500,000 after 5 years, we can use the formula for compound interest: A = P * (1 + r/n)^(nt)
Where A is the amount after t years, P is the initial deposit (the amount being invested), r is the interest rate as a decimal, n is the number of times the interest is compounded per year, and t is the number of years the money is invested.
Given the information, we have:
A = 500,000
r = 0.10 (10% interest rate)
n = 1 (interest is compounded annually)
t = 5
So, substituting into the formula:
500,000 = P * (1 + 0.10/1)^(1 * 5)
Solving for P:
P = 500,000 / (1 + 0.10/1)^(1 * 5)
P = 500,000 / 1.610526
P = ₱309,724.07
Therefore, the couple should place ₱309,724.07 in a time deposit to have ₱500,000 after 5 years at 10% interest compounded interest annually.

Carla i going on a boat tour. The boat will travel a total ditance of 20 kilometer during the 5-hour tour. If the boat travel at a contant peed during the tour, what ditance in kilometer hould the boat travel in 3 hour?
12
15
18
33
The correct answer is option A. The boat should travel 12 kilometers in 3 hours.
Since the boat will travel a total distance of 20 kilometers during the 5-hour tour, and the speed is constant, we can calculate the average speed of the boat by dividing the total distance by the total time: 20 kilometers / 5 hours = 4 kilometers per hour.
To find the distance the boat should travel in 3 hours, we multiply the average speed by the time: 4 kilometers per hour * 3 hours = 12 kilometers.
In summary, the boat should travel 12 kilometers in 3 hours because the average speed is 4 kilometers per hour and the time is 3 hours.

Identify all the solutions to the following-inequality.
3(x - 3) ≤ 27
Answer: [tex]x \leq 12[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
[tex]3(x-3) \leq 27\\\\x-3 \leq 9\\\\x \leq 12[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
To solve the inequality 3(x - 3) ≤ 27, we can use the following steps:
Distribute the 3 on the left side of the inequality: 3x - 9 ≤ 27
Add 9 to both sides of the inequality: 3x ≤ 36
Divide both sides of the inequality by 3: x ≤ 12
Therefore, the solution to the inequality is x ≤ 12.
This solution is valid for any value of x less than or equal to 12, including 12.
Examples of values that satisfy this inequality are:
x = -6, -4, -2, 0, 2, 4, 6, 8, 10, 11, 12
x = -1, -0.5, 0.1, 4.5, 8.9, 12
Note that the solution set is a set of real numbers, that includes all x that are less or equal than 12.
The life of cell batteries is normally distributed with a mean of 68.3 hours and a standard deviation of 18.4 hours. 93% of the batteries will last more than how many hours? (2 decimal places )
The life of cell batteries is normally distributed with a mean of 68.3 hours and a standard deviation of 18.4 hours. 93% of the batteries will last more than 41.15 hours.
A mean = 68.3 hours
A standard deviation(SD) = 18.4 hours
We have to determine 93% of the batteries will last more than how many hours.
P(x > x(1)) = 93%
P(x > x(1)) = 0.93
1 - P(x ≤ x(1)) = 0.93
Now solving
P(x ≤ x(1)) = 0.07
P(z ≤ (x(1) - mean)/SD) = 0.07
P(z ≤ (x(1) - 68.3)/18.4) = 0.07
P(z ≤ (x(1) - 68.3)/18.4) = 0.07
Using the z table
(x(1) - 68.3)/18.4 = -1.4758
Multiply by 18.4 on both side, we get
x(1) - 68.3 = -27.15472
Add 68.3 on both side, we get
x(1) = 41.14528
x(1) = 41.15 hours

Shayna and Kali are selling wrapping paper for a school fundraiser. Customers can buy rolls of
plain wrapping paper and rolls of shiny wrapping paper. Shayna sold 5 rolls of plain wrapping
paper and 3 rolls of shiny wrapping paper for a total of $57. Kali sold 11 rolls of plain wrapping
paper and 3 rolls of shiny wrapping paper for a total of $93. Find the cost each of one roll of
plain wrapping paper and one roll of shiny wrapping paper.
(PLS HELP ASAP!!!!)
Answer:
The cost of plain wrapping paper is $6 and cost of shiny wrapping paper is $9
Step-by-step explanation:
cost of plain wrapping paper = x
cost of shiny wrapping paper = y
so the equation will be:-
5x + 3y = 57
11x + 3y = 93
by subtracting 3y from the equation we get :-
6x = 36
x = 6
5(6) + 3y = 57
30 +3y = 57
3y = 27
y = 9
hence, the cost of plain wrapping paper is $6 and cost of shiny wrapping paper is $9
